Output 2531830cabaf90387f257a0ae28562cfac2986e8767afc4f6cbf9126eb772e33:5
- value
- 384469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5bf0320f7dce6a3c375efd07ee20e149a41c16d OP_EQUAL
- address
- 3MBCgAYuaurFeV6AxdKcxJXLfAHej4Kx3s
- transaction
- 2531830cabaf90387f257a0ae28562cfac2986e8767afc4f6cbf9126eb772e33
- spent
- true